Specialized trailers for I-Beams

I-Beams call for trailer selection that matches length, weight, and center of gravity. For many moves, RGNs, lowboys, step decks, double drops, and multi-axle trailers give the needed clearance and support. Heavy Haulers choose the setup based on beam length, bundle count, and whether the load needs extra deck space or lower ride height. A step deck can work for moderate lengths, while a lowboy or double drop helps with height-sensitive cargo and taller route obstacles. Multi-axle trailers spread weight for heavier steel packages and help with axle compliance on Florida roads. Heavy Haul Transporting also looks at tie-down points, edge protection, and blocking so the beams stay stable during long-haul trucking. Flatbed trucking companies may move standard freight, but structural steel needs a carrier that understands over-dimensional hauling and the way long, rigid cargo behaves in motion. Our Team matches the trailer to the beam, not the other way around.

Permits, escorts, and Florida route planning

Florida oversize moves demand careful planning, especially when the cargo is long enough to affect lane position and turning clearance. Heavy Haulers coordinate permits, escort needs, and route surveys before the truck leaves the port area. For I-Beams, height, width, overhang, and total weight all matter, along with bridge clearances and local restrictions. Around Cape Canaveral, routes often connect through SR 528, A1A, US-1, I-95, and nearby industrial corridors, but each move still needs a fresh review. Heavy Haulers work through the details that matter on the road: construction zones, traffic patterns, median openings, and utility conflicts. Oversized load trucking in Florida can also require pilot cars or escorts depending on dimensions and route conditions. Heavy Haul Transporting builds the move around the permit limits, not around assumptions. That means checking state rules, county access, and route geometry before dispatch. For steel, the difference between a smooth trip and a delay is usually in the planning stage.
